目次
1. イントロダクション
2. 開封とセットアップ
3. キーボードとデザイン
4. VS Codeのインストール
5. オフライン作業
6. Figmaでのデザイン
7. Chromebookでのプログラミング
8. ユーザーフィードバックと体験
9. 結論
イントロダクション
この記事では、新しいAsus Chromebookがプログラミングに適しているかどうかについて探求し、その機能、パフォーマンス、開発者向けの使いやすさについて詳しく説明します。さらに、プログラミングタスクにChromebookを使用する利点と制限についても議論します。Asus Chromebookがあなたのプログラミングニーズに適しているかどうかを調べてみましょう。
開封とセットアップ
Asus Chromebookを開封すると、USB-C、USB 3、HDMI、ヘッドフォンジャックなど、さまざまなポートを備えた他のChromebookとは異なる追加機能が備わっていることに驚かされました。プログラマーにとって重要なキーボードは、反応性の高いキーと広いバックライトで私を感動させました。テンキーと矢印キーの専用ボタンが付いていることで、利便性と使いやすさが向上しました。セットアッププロセスは簡単で、Googleログインを要求し、ブックマーク、拡張機能、ブラウジング履歴をすべてシームレスに同期するだけでした。
キーボードとデザイン
Asus Chromebookのキーボードは、プログラマーにとって貴重な資産でした。快適なキーバウンスと広いレイアウトにより、タイピングが簡単になりました。バックライト機能により、低照度条件でも視認性が確保されました。Chromebook自体のデザインは、大きな16インチの画面を備え、コーディングやデザイン作業に十分なスペースを提供する、スリムでモダンなものでした。柔軟な視野角を可能にするタブレットモードは、研究や学習目的に特に役立ちました。
VS Codeのインストール
お気に入りのIDEであるVisual Studio Code(VS Code)をChromebookで利用するには、やや異なるインストールプロセスを実行する必要がありました。ChromebookはChrome OSで動作するため、Linux互換のDevバージョンのVS Codeをダウンロードする必要がありました。必要なパッケージをインストールするなどの追加の手順を踏んで、私はChromebookでVS Codeを正常に設定することができました。また、同期機能を利用して、好みの拡張機能をインポートし、馴染みのあるコーディング環境を確保しました。
オフライン作業
最初は誤解していましたが、Chromebookはインターネット接続なしでも機能することがわかりました。一般的なブラウジングは制限されますが、VS Codeなどの多くのアプリケーションはオフラインで動作します。このオフライン機能により、移動中のプログラミングに頼れる信頼性の高い選択肢となりました。ただし、データベースやファイルのバックアップなどの準備が必要な場合があることに注意してください。
Figmaでのデザイン
Asus Chromebookを使用した経験での驚きの一つは、デザイン作業に適していることでした。Figmaなどのアプリケーションを使用することで、簡単にデザインを作成および変更することができました。Chromebookの広い画面と直感的なインターフェイスにより、ウェブサイトやアプリケーションのデザイン作業がスムーズに行えました。デザイナーや開発者にとって、Chromebookは快適で効率的な環境を提供しました。
Chromebookでのプログラミング
Asus Chromebookは、プログラミングタスクにおいて私の期待を上回りました。Intel Core iシリーズプロセッサを搭載しており、ほとんどの開発ニーズに十分なパワーを提供してくれました。VS Codeをスムーズに実行し、Reactプロジェクトを作成し、フロントエンドおよびバックエンドの開発タスクを処理することができました。Chromebookのパフォーマンスは、従来のラップトップと同等であり、移動中のコーディングに適した選択肢となりました。ただし、iOSやAndroidデバイスのエミュレーションなど、リソースを多く必要とするタスクには、より強力なハードウェアが必要になる場合があります。
ユーザーフィードバックと体験
調査や議論を行った結果、多くのプログラマーや学生が、コーディングにChromebookを使用していることがわかりました。手頃な価格、携帯性、FreeCodeCampなどのオンライン学習プラットフォームとの互換性が、Chromebookを魅力的な選択肢にしています。軽量なデバイスでコーディングタスクを処理できる便利さは、ユーザーにとって魅力的な点です。